    Please Mum today announced to staff and customers that 70 of their retail locations would be closed by end of day today. I think managers were alerted late Sunday night. Presently 21 stores and their online store remain open, We have not been able to redeem or issue gift cards since Saturday and the remaining stores still cannot redeem them. All merchandise sold today or later is final sale so it looks as though the other stores may follow shortly after us.
